Abstract :
This paper deals with two-dimensional EHD flow occurring between a blade and a plate electrode a distance H apart. This type of EHD flow, known as electrohydrodynamic plumes, arises when sharp metallic contours submerged in nonconducting liquids support high electrostatic potential resulting in charge injection. The aim of this paper is to analyze, from a numerical point of view, the evolution of velocity profiles, flow pattern and other relevant parameters characterizing plumes flows. Numerical results are compared with those obtained from experimental or theoretical works found in literature and show that the numerical technique used is suitable to study EHD plumes.
